Muth's cover art is rendered in luminous watercolor washes — a solitary figure seen from behind stands against a hazy, amber-and-rose sky, while a framed vignette above captures a red-haired young woman in a dreamlike, intimate portrait. The two images together evoke longing and distance in a way that feels more like fine art than a comic cover, making "In a Lone Land" an especially beautiful installment to have on your shelf.
